Output ab8112833eba78734cf9a1e5ec107572fab8f3578e87d5883d34a74297ae1e51:21

value
65572397
script pubkey
OP_0 OP_PUSHBYTES_20 a3da162ddb2b4145c6b2197880931c037a88e8d9
address
bc1q50dpvtwm9dq5t34jr9ugpycuqdag36xe8n9eke
transaction
ab8112833eba78734cf9a1e5ec107572fab8f3578e87d5883d34a74297ae1e51
spent
true